大家好,今天小编关注到一个比较有意思的话题,就是关于熟悉网络系统架构的人叫什么的问题,于是小编就整理了1个相关介绍熟悉网络系统架构的人叫什么的解答,让我们一起看看吧。
谁能给个网络安全的学习路线啊?
第一部分:基础篇。主要包括安全导论、安全法律法规、操作系统应用、计算机网络、HTML&JS、PHP编程、Python编程和Docker基础知识。让初级入门的人员对网络安全基础有所了解。
第二部分:Web安全。包含Web安全概述、Web安全基础、Web安全漏洞及防御和企业Web安全防护策略方面的安全知识。让初学者入门学习Web安全知识。
第三部分:渗透测试。这个阶段包括的内容有,渗透测试概述、渗透测试环境搭建、渗透测试工具使用、信息收集与社工技巧、Web渗透、中间件渗透和内网渗透等知识。
第四部分:代码审计。包括了代码审计概述、PHP代码审计、Python代码审计、Java代码审计、C/C++代码审计和代码审计实战的知识,深入学习各类代码审计的知识。
第五部分:安全加固。这个阶段的学习,可以深入学习网络协议安全、密码学及应用、操作系统安全配置等方面的重要知识点。
第六部分:企业篇。学习企业安全建设、等保原理、等保制度建设以及等保测评实践。最后部分是深入了解企业级项目的实战学习。
网络安全是一个交叉学科,学习路线比较广,我给出一个参考路线如下:
1. 基础知识:操作系统、计算机网络、数据库、编程语言(Python、Java等)等。这些基础知识是学习网络安全的前提。
2. 网络安全概论:了解网络安全的基本概念、发展历史、技术方法和管理要素等。这可以帮助你建立一个总体框架,为后续学习提供方向。
3. 加密算法:对称/非对称加密算法、哈希算法、数字签名等。加密算法是网络安全的基石。
4. 网络协议与系统:TCP/IP、DNS、FTP、SSH、IDS等协议与系统。熟悉常见网络协议与系统架构,这有助于发现和防御安全漏洞。
5. 入侵检测与防御:不同类型网络攻击方法与入侵检测技术、防火墙、入侵检测系统等防御手段。这是网络安全技术的重点内容。
6. 网络安全管理:安全策略、标准与规范、风险评估与控制、漏洞管理等管理知识。管理技能同样重要。
7. 漏洞研究与攻击技术:熟悉常见网络设备、操作系统和软件的漏洞与利用方法。“知己知彼”的思想,有助于防御技术的提高。
8. 实践项目:参与开源安全项目或CTF挑战赛等实践机会。实践可以帮助理论知识的内化与提高。
除了技术与理论知识外,学习网络安全还需要对法律法规、安全标准与规范有所了解。同时,网络安全也需要广泛的信息搜集与分析能力。
总之,网络安全学习路线广而多态,既需要扎实的技术与理论基础,也需要宽广的知识面与动手实践能力。量少而精,除专业方向外,也需要具备多角度的思考视角。这需要你通过学习与实践不断积累与提高。
我希望以上路线能对你有所帮助,在学习网络安全过程中,对任何问题都欢迎与我讨论!我愿意为你提供更详细的学习计划与指导。
第一阶段
基础理论学习篇
安全理论知识
安全法律法规
操作系统应用
计算机网络
HTMLJS
PHP编程
Python编程
Docker基础知识
第二阶段
web安全知识学习
web安全基础知识
web安全漏洞及防御
企业web安全防护策略
第三阶段
渗透测试方法学习
渗透测试基础知识
渗透测试环境搭建
渗透测试工具使用
信息收集与社工技巧
web渗透
中间件渗透
内网渗透
第四阶段
代码审计
代码审计基础知识
python代码审计
Java代码审计
c/c++代码审计
代码审计实战
第五阶段
安全知识深入加固
网络协议安全
密码学及应用
操作系统安全配置
第六阶段
企业安全知识
企业安全建设知识学习
主要是需要持之以恒的学习,贵在坚持。
到此,以上就是小编对于熟悉网络系统架构的人叫什么的问题就介绍到这了,希望介绍关于熟悉网络系统架构的人叫什么的1点解答对大家有用。